A small sigh of relief.

I just got off the phone with my PCP and I had gotten my T3 and T4 done to check my thyroid last week. 

A month ago my TSH was 2.97 which I felt was a bit high as the levels go from .3 to 3. So I requested a T3 and T4 since I had that miscarriage I wanted to make sure my thyroid was ok. The normal for T4 is 4.5 to 12.5 mine was 7.8 and for the T3 the normal range is from 80 to 220 and mine was 116. So basically said...my thyroid is ok! Which is a small relief. Now onto my other doctor tomorrow to check for endo and other issues.
